The white wine Schloßböckelheim Felsenberg Felsentürmchen Riesling, vintage 2011 from the winery Weingut Dönnhoff has been rated in 2012 with 94 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Riesling from the region Nahe in Germany.
Tasting Notes
Pale white yellow with greenish reflections. Rocky nose, completely pure, a different dimension, even more gripping than the Hermannshöhle the old Dönnoff icon. Enormously exciting and purist on the palate, long-lasting, bursting with tension, huge ageing potential. One of the most exciting dry Dönis Rieslings in history.
